Standardised press units
In order to let also customers and industries using a lower degree automation share the benefits offered by these mechanical fastening techniques on an economical basis Arnold & Shinjo has developed the C-shape punching unit.
This solution for the separate workplace permits to process the PIAS® piercing nuts and several types of clinch studs.
The modular design allows the installation of the processing tools for placing the fastening elements from above as well as from below.
There are various optional variants available for feeding the fastening elements:
- Feeding the fastening elements by hand
- Feeding the fastening elements by means of refillable magazines
- Feeding the fastening elements by means of vibratory spiral conveyor
The elements are clinched by a pneumatic-hydraulic cylinder. This affords quick strokes with a minimum of air consumption.
Complete column frame for manual insertion
This tool was designed for processing two different component parts. Part 1 with 2 clinch studs M6 x 20 can be worked from one side of the column frame. After rotating the tool part 2 can be produced. The clinch heads are adapted in an optimal manner to the respective pre-punched holes.
Tube punching plant Miracress
How would you insert a piercing nut into a square tube 50x50 mm in one single operation?
In conjunction with the trend to "multi-material design" and to composites in the automotive industry there is an increasing demand for mechanical joining methods.
In case of tube-shaped components in particular, fastening of threaded inserts is requiring a multi-stage process. So far, this was technically not possible with piercing nuts.
This challenge has now been met by means of an absolutely new technology using a slender, flexible arm. The nut with thread size M5 to M12 is joined to the tube from inside by a form-fitting connection without a pre-punched hole. The component part can be attached on the outside.
